I have mine set up to send me an email.  I don't use ATX, but I do use CCH.  Also, on the electronic filing status screen I can click on a return ID and get a printable and exportable pop-up that includes the e-Postmark date and details right down to each state acceptance (for the few states I can e-file extensions) and the Submission ID.  I can do all that from within the client's return as well.

Every time I've been asked for one, I just had the client send the lender a copy of the 4868.

I've never had a question come back requesting any sort of proof of acceptance.
